About The Position

The Tools and Parts Attendant receives, stores, and issues hand tools, machine tools, dies, replacement parts, shop supplies and equipment, such as measuring devices. This role involves maintaining records of tools, searching for lost items, preparing inventory, unpacking new equipment, inspecting tools for defects, and potentially coating tools with preservatives or attaching identification tags. The attendant is responsible for monitoring the condition of all tools and equipment in their custody, maintaining tracking of calibrated tools and special equipment, and handling hazardous materials. All work must be performed in accordance with applicable policies and assigned tasks. The position requires the ability to recognize a variety of tools and perform other related duties as assigned.

Responsibilities

  • Receives, stores, and issues hand tools, machine tools, dies, replacement parts, shop supplies and equipment, such as measuring devices.
  • Keeps records of tools issued to and returned by workers.
  • Searches for lost or misplaced tools.
  • Prepares periodic inventory or keeps perpetual inventory and requisitions stock as needed.
  • Unpacks and stores new equipment.
  • Visually inspects tools or measures with micrometer for wear or defects and reports damaged or worn-out equipment to superiors.
  • May coat tools with grease or other preservative, using a brush or spray gun.
  • May attach identification tags or engrave identifying information on tools and equipment using electric marking tool.
  • Monitors condition of all tools and equipment in tool room custody and is responsible for accountability of all tool inventories.
  • Must maintain tracking and identification of calibrated tools and special equipment.
  • Issue/receive and handle hazmat.
